Victor Adam created this lithograph, "Historische optocht bij het tweede eeuwfeest van de Utrechtse Hogeschool, 1836," in 1836. Its panoramic view presents a procession as a series of structured groupings. The composition unfolds linearly, each contingent meticulously spaced, offering a study in pattern and variation. Adam masterfully employs line to define form, from the soldiers' rigid ranks to the billowing flags, contrasting with the organic shapes of the horses. The lithographic technique gives the work a textural depth, emphasizing the materiality of the scene. The arrangement reflects a deep investment in the representational codes of power and history. Each grouping, while part of the whole, maintains its distinct character through subtle variations in posture and accoutrements. This suggests a semiotic system where each element contributes to a collective narrative, challenging static interpretations of historical events. Adam's structured rendering invites us to decode the layers of meaning inherent in its arrangement.
